Output 0973f6289124c2558d9faa7d180fa69ef18a323f367273b44b6a330173e06aaf:62

value
362988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ad6a1f3bc9f1833e6aa81247b89fe1b531ef7e9 OP_EQUAL
address
3CtXUtBjXaEGwgyWKfsEFAGW6Wos9FYi4y
transaction
0973f6289124c2558d9faa7d180fa69ef18a323f367273b44b6a330173e06aaf
confirmations
266209
spent
true